The African American Experience in Texas collects for the first time the finest historical research and writing on African Americans in Texas. Covering the time period between 1820 and the late 1970s, the selections highlight the significant role that black Texans played in the development of the state. This book surveys the life and work of black cattle drivers from the years before the Civil War through the turn of the twentieth century. It includes previously published articles and new research, this collection also features select accounts of twentieth-century rodeos, music, people, and films.
